What are Cloud Services?
Blog post from PubNub
Cloud services, encompassing IT capabilities, resources, or infrastructure delivered by cloud utility providers or via cloud-oriented software, have become integral to modern technology, impacting both everyday life and business operations. They are offered through public, private, and hybrid cloud environments, each catering to different user needs. The primary service categories include Infrastructure-as-a-Service (IaaS), which provides scalable computing resources; Software-as-a-Service (SaaS), delivering software over the internet; Platform-as-a-Service (PaaS), offering environments for application development; and Application Programming Interfaces (APIs), which facilitate sophisticated functionalities with ease. These cloud service models have revolutionized software architecture, enabling the shift from monolithic to microservice-oriented applications, allowing developers to craft unique experiences by integrating publicly available services. As the foundation of distributed applications, cloud services ensure global accessibility and rapid response times, illustrating their crucial role in shaping the future of software innovation and data interaction.
